Gothenburg, Sweden is home to a multitude of metal bands – including female-fronted ones.  We’ve already featured two here at Unleash the Furies: Amaranthe, and One Without. Both of these bands offer more extreme, grunt-heavy music.  However, you’ll get something a little different from Ultimate Fate. Their music is equally as dynamic and powerful, but also lush and romantic.

Ultimate Fate formed in 2008 when former Violator bandmates Ola Olsson and Jacob Hede reunited with the goal of creating a more melodic style of metal. (Violator is a thrash metal band.) They also wanted a female vocalist for this project. It wasn’t long before they met Jennie Nord – and the sound of Ultimate Fate began to take shape. That sound is not exactly classically influenced symphonic metal, but more of a melodic heavy metal with a symphonic backdrop.  In other words, Ultimate Fate seems to concentrate on getting the metal down first before adding the synth-strings.  So, you’ll hear robust guitars and smooth rhythms, with the symphonics coming in at the right moments and only as necessary. Also, Jennie has a cool voice compared to most female symphonic metal singers. It’s a mid-range (contralto or alto, maybe?) voice that can be soft and tender, then reach the same wild heights that remind me of Kate Bush.

In April of this year, Ultimate Fate released a three-song EP called Beyond the Horizon. Each song has its own character, yet showcases that distinct Ultimate Fate sound. I was (and still am) particularly impressed by the chemistry I can hear and feel in the music. All of the instruments and elements seem to come together so naturally. Currently, Ultimate Fate is working on songs for their first full-length album. Some live dates may be coming soon, too. So keep your eyes and ears open for this band!

Ultimate Fate are:

  • Jennie Nord: Vocals
  • Jacob Hede: Guitar
  • Niklas Fahlén: Bass
  • Ola Olsson: Drums
  • Andreas Bergqvist: Keyboards
